Content:
图片来源于网络,如有侵权联系删除
Are you intrigued by the complexities of English website navigation source code? Do you wish to delve into the intricate details of how websites are structured and navigated? Look no further! In this comprehensive guide, we will explore the mysteries of English website navigation source code, providing you with an in-depth understanding of its components, functionalities, and best practices.
1、Introduction to English Website Navigation Source Code
English website navigation source code refers to the underlying HTML, CSS, and JavaScript that enables users to navigate through a website. It plays a crucial role in ensuring a seamless user experience by providing clear and intuitive navigation options. By understanding the source code, you can optimize your website's structure, improve accessibility, and enhance overall performance.
2、Understanding HTML in English Website Navigation Source Code
HTML (Hypertext Markup Language) serves as the backbone of any website. It defines the structure and content of web pages. In the context of English website navigation, HTML elements are used to create navigation menus, links, and other interactive components. Let's explore some essential HTML elements commonly used in navigation:
a. Navigation Menu: A navigation menu is a collection of links that allow users to access different sections of a website. It is typically structured using HTML unordered lists (ul) and list items (li) elements. For example:
<ul> <li><a href="home.html">Home</a></li> <li><a href="about.html">About Us</a></li> <li><a href="services.html">Services</a></li> <li><a href="contact.html">Contact</a></li> </ul>
b. Anchor Tags: Anchor tags (a) are used to create hyperlinks that allow users to navigate to different pages within the same website or external websites. For example:
<a href="https://www.example.com">Visit Example.com</a>
c. Navigation Bar: A navigation bar is a horizontal or vertical bar that contains the navigation menu. It can be implemented using HTML div (division) elements and styled with CSS.
3、CSS in English Website Navigation Source Code
图片来源于网络,如有侵权联系删除
CSS (Cascading Style Sheets) is responsible for the visual presentation of web pages. In English website navigation source code, CSS is used to style navigation menus, links, and other components. Here are some key CSS properties and techniques for styling navigation:
a. Font Styles: You can use CSS font properties to style the text in navigation menus, such as font-size, font-family, and font-weight.
ul { font-family: Arial, sans-serif; font-size: 16px; font-weight: bold; }
b. Colors: CSS color properties can be used to define the colors of navigation menus, links, and other components. For example:
ul { color: #333; } a { color: #007bff; }
c. Backgrounds and Borders: CSS properties like background-color, background-image, and border can be used to enhance the visual appeal of navigation menus.
ul { background-color: #f5f5f5; border: 1px solid #ccc; }
4、JavaScript in English Website Navigation Source Code
JavaScript is a programming language that adds interactivity to web pages. In English website navigation source code, JavaScript can be used to enhance the functionality of navigation menus, such as implementing dropdown menus, sticky headers, and animated transitions.
a. Dropdown Menus: Dropdown menus allow users to access additional options when hovering over a parent menu item. Here's an example of a simple dropdown menu using JavaScript:
<ul> <li><a href="home.html">Home</a></li> <li><a href="about.html">About Us</a> <ul> <li><a href="team.html">Our Team</a></li> <li><a href="history.html">Company History</a></li> </ul> </li> <li><a href="services.html">Services</a></li> <li><a href="contact.html">Contact</a></li> </ul>
b. Sticky Headers: A sticky header remains fixed at the top of the page as the user scrolls. Here's an example of implementing a sticky header using JavaScript:
<div id="header"> <h1>Website Title</h1> </div>
#header { position: sticky; top: 0; background-color: #f5f5f5; padding: 10px; }
5、Best Practices for English Website Navigation Source Code
图片来源于网络,如有侵权联系删除
To ensure a user-friendly and accessible navigation experience, consider the following best practices when working with English website navigation source code:
a. Consistency: Maintain a consistent navigation structure and style across your website to help users navigate effortlessly.
b. Clarity: Use clear and concise labels for navigation menu items, making it easy for users to understand their purpose.
c. Accessibility: Ensure that your navigation menu is accessible to users with disabilities, such as screen readers, by using appropriate HTML attributes likearia-label
andaria-haspopup
.
d. Performance: Optimize your website's performance by minimizing the use of heavy JavaScript libraries and optimizing your CSS and HTML code.
In conclusion, English website navigation source code is a crucial component of web development. By understanding the intricacies of HTML, CSS, and JavaScript, you can create a seamless and accessible navigation experience for your users. This comprehensive guide has provided you with a foundation to explore the secrets of English website navigation source code and implement best practices in your web projects.
标签: #英文网站导航 源码
评论列表